Course Introduction and Description:
Sheringham Golf Club was founded in 1891. It is a varied course enjoying views off its cliff top site. The most spectacular holes are those at the very edge of the cliffs. 5th, 6th and 7th, but as the course edges in land, gorse becomes a persistent threat.
The Club has a distinguished golfing history and is proud to have hosted many major amateur events. Many of golf's most famous names have also played here. Henry Cotton is quoted, "Sheringham has a charm that belongs to itself ... and is one of the best kept secrets in golf… Sheringham's golf course is special."
The undulating fairways and fast, true greens will prove a test to all standards of golfer. There is a large practice area with bunkers and facilities including pitching areas, practice nets and practice putting greens, there is also an indoor practice and coaching facility.
Photographs of the great Harry Vardon who partnered James Braid in a 36 holes foursomes match at Sheringham against J H Taylor and Arnaud Massy in September 1908 (all were Open Champions) as well as other historical artefacts line both sides of the corridor and you instantly start to feel the unique atmosphere of this prestigious venue.
Course Statistics:
Category: Cliff Top
No. of Holes: 18 holes
Yardage: White 6456, Yellow 6160, Red 5752
Par: White par 70 - sss 72 , Yellow par 70 - sss 70, Red par 73 & sss 73
